Additional Information
1888. Ashlar. 4 steps up. Base with projecting semi-circular bowls on gadrooned oriels. 8 fluted Tuscan columns (2 at each corner, placed diagonally) taking
4 semi-circular arches with keystones and moulded voussoirs. Fluted frieze.
Moulded cornice. Ogee corona of ribs and fleur-de-lys finials. Each side has much strapwork cresting. Plaque inscribed "THE GIFT OF SIR JOHN W RAMSDEN
BART TO HUDDERSFIELD 1888".
